7013 FE/HCP4A Bearing Product Overview & Core Advantages
The 7013 FE/HCP4A is a high-precision angular contact ball bearing designed for demanding applications requiring exceptional rotational accuracy and rigidity. Engineered with ceramic balls and manufactured to P4A tolerance class, this bearing delivers superior performance in high-speed and high-rigidity scenarios. Its single-row design is preloaded and optimized to handle significant combined loads, making it an ideal choice for precision spindles and other critical machinery components where reliability is paramount.
7013 FE/HCP4A Bearing Model Code Explained, Specifications & Naming Convention
| Code Segment | Technical Meaning |
|---|---|
| 7013 | Standard bearing series designation, indicating a metric bore diameter of 65mm and outside diameter of 100mm. |
| FE | Indicates a specific internal design, typically referring to an optimized contact angle and internal geometry for high performance. |
| HC | Signifies the use of Hybrid Ceramic balls (Silicon Nitride), which reduce friction, heat generation, and wear. |
| P4A | Denotes an ultra-precision tolerance class with extremely tight dimensional and running accuracy tolerances, superior to standard ABEC 7/P4. |
7013 FE/HCP4A Bearing Structural Features & Performance Benefits
Hybrid Ceramic Construction: The combination of chrome steel rings and ceramic balls significantly reduces centrifugal forces and friction, enabling higher limiting speeds (32,500 rpm) and extended service life. This construction also provides superior resistance to thermal expansion mismatches.
High Rigidity & Preload: The bearing is supplied with a preload, which eliminates internal clearance. This results in high system rigidity, precise shaft positioning, and reduced vibration under combined radial and axial loads.
Phenolic Cage for High-Speed Operation: The lightweight and robust phenolic resin cage ensures stable operation at high speeds, contributing to the bearing's excellent high-speed performance.
Precision & Reliability: Manufactured to P4A tolerance class, this bearing guarantees minimal runout and consistent performance, which is critical for applications requiring the highest levels of accuracy.
7013 FE/HCP4A Bearing Typical Application Areas
The 7013 FE/HCP4A is ideally suited for high-performance applications where speed, precision, and rigidity are non-negotiable. Key industries and equipment include:
- Machine Tool Spindles: High-speed milling, grinding, and turning centers.
- Precision Robotics: Arm joints and spindle drives requiring high positional accuracy.
- Aerospace & Defense: Gyroscopes, navigation systems, and auxiliary power units.
- High-Frequency Motors and Spindles: Used in PCB drilling and semiconductor manufacturing equipment.
